Ведение точного учета отработанного времени является фундаментом корректного начисления заработной платы и соблюдения трудового законодательства. В системе 1С:Зарплата и управление персоналом документ «Табель учета рабочего времени» выступает ключевым регистратором явок и неявок сотрудников за отчетный период. Однако в реальной рабочей практике часто возникают ситуации, когда требуется внести правки в уже сформированные данные.
Необходимость корректировок может быть вызвана различными факторами: от банальных опечаток кадровика до позднего предоставления больничных листов или приказов о командировках. Важно понимать, что система 1С:ЗУП обладает жесткой логикой связей между документами, поэтому простое изменение цифры в ячейке таблицы не всегда допустимо или возможно технически. Процесс внесения изменений зависит от статуса документа и причины возникшей расхождения.
В данном материале мы детально разберем алгоритмы действий для различных сценариев: от редактирования открытого табеля до проведения сложных ретроспективных исправлений через документы-основания. Вы узнаете, как правильно использовать механизмы ручного ввода кодов явок и какие последствия могут возникнуть при изменении данных задним числом.
Статусы документа и возможность редактирования
Первым шагом перед попыткой внести любые правки является анализ текущего состояния документа в информационной базе. Система 1С:Предприятие строго разграничивает документы по статусу проведения, что напрямую влияет на доступные пользователю действия. Если табель еще не проведен, он находится в режиме черновика, и пользователь обладает полными правами на изменение любых ячеек, графика работы и списочного состава.
Однако, если документ уже проведен, поля ввода становятся недоступными для прямого редактирования. Это сделано для защиты целостности данных и предотвращения ситуаций, когда расчет зарплаты произведен по одним данным, а в табеле они отличаются. В таком случае система требует использования специализированных механизмов исправления или перепроведения документов.
⚠️ Внимание! Прямое изменение данных в проведенном табеле через режим «1С:Предприятие» (конфигуратор) или отключение контроля проведения категорически не рекомендуется. Это приводит к рассинхронизации регистров накопления и ошибкам при расчете среднего заработка или отпускных.
Для проверки статуса откройте список табелей за нужный месяц и обратите внимание на иконку документа. Проведенный документ обычно помечается специальным значком или имеет пометку «Проведен» в шапке формы. Если вам необходимо изменить данные в таком документе, единственным легитимным путем является создание нового корректирующего документа или использование функции «Исправление в оперативном учете», если такая возможность предусмотрена версией конфигурации.
Внесение изменений в незаполненные дни текущего месяца
Наиболее простая ситуация возникает, когда отчетный период еще не завершен, и вы обнаруживаете ошибку в днях, которые еще не были табелированы или были заполнены автоматически неверно. В этом случае вы работаете с документом, который еще не участвовал в финальных расчетах зарплаты за месяц. Алгоритм действий здесь максимально прозрачен и не требует создания дополнительных документов-оснований.
Вам необходимо открыть сам документ Табель учета рабочего времени из журнала документов. Перейдите на вкладку Явки и неявки, где представлена основная сетка данных. Найдите строку с фамилией сотрудника и столбец, соответствующий дате исправления. Система позволяет переопределять автоматически подставленные значения из графика работы вручную.
Для изменения типа времени используйте выпадающий список в ячейке. Вы можете выбрать любой код из классификатора, например, заменить плановую явку Я на отпуск ОТ или больничный Б. После изменения кода явки система автоматически пересчитает количество часов, если это предусмотрено настройками вида времени, но в некоторых случаях потребуется ручной ввод количества часов в соседнюю ячейку.
- 📝 Проверьте соответствие кода явки внутреннему классификатору вашей организации.
- ⏱ Убедитесь, что сумма часов за день не превышает установленную норму, если это не сверхурочная работа.
- 💾 Обязательно сохраните изменения кнопкой
Записатьперед закрытием формы документа.
Если вы изменили данные, необходимо перепровести документ, чтобы обновить движения по регистрам. Нажмите кнопку Провести и закрыть. После этого изменения вступят в силу и будут учтены при следующем запуске расчета зарплаты. Помните, что автоматическое заполнение может перезаписать ваши ручные правки при повторном запуске помощника заполнения, поэтому фиксируйте итоговый вариант документа.
Если вы часто меняете один и тот же код явки, используйте быструю замену: выделите диапазон ячеек, нажмите правую кнопку мыши и выберите «Заполнить» -> «Заполнить кодом явки».
Корректировка через документы-основания (ретроспектива)
Ситуация усложняется, если ошибка обнаружена в прошлом периоде, который уже был рассчитан, или если изменение явки должно быть подтверждено официальным приказом. В методологии 1С:ЗУП действует принцип: «Табель отражает факты, подтвержденные документами». Следовательно, нельзя просто поменять код в табеле задним числом без документального обоснования.
Для исправления ошибок в прошлых периодах необходимо создать документ, являющийся основанием для изменения данных. В зависимости от ситуации это может быть Отсутствие сотрудника, Больничный лист, Отпуск или Изменение графика работы. Эти документы вводятся датой фактического события, даже если эта дата относится к прошлому месяцу.
После проведения документа-основания система автоматически сформирует новые движения по регистрам. Однако, чтобы эти изменения отразились в табеле, может потребоваться перегенерация самого табеля или его перепроведение. В новых версиях конфигурации существует механизм, при котором табель «подтягивает» данные из документов-оснований при своем проведении.
| Тип изменения | Документ-основание в 1С | Влияние на расчет |
|---|---|---|
| Сотрудник заболел | Больничный лист | Пересчет среднего заработка, исключение из стажа |
| Отпуск без сохранения ЗП | Отсутствие сотрудника (код НВ) | Уменьшение фонда оплаты труда, пересчет нормы часов |
| Командировка | Командировка | Сохранение среднего заработка, оплата по среднему |
| Смена графика | Изменение графика работы | Изменение плановой нормы часов с даты начала действия |
Критически важно соблюдать хронологию документов. Если вы вносите больничный лист задним числом, убедитесь, что он проводится до момента окончательного закрытия месяца и выплаты зарплаты. В противном случае вам придется использовать механизм перерасчета, что значительно усложнит процедуру и потребует сторнирования предыдущих начислений.
Что делать, если месяц уже закрыт?
Если период закрыт и сдан регламентированный отчет, внесение изменений требует открытия периода. Это делается через обработку «Закрытие месяца» или административные настройки прав доступа. После открытия периода внесите документ-основание, перепроведите табель и пересчитайте зарплату.
Ручной ввод и переопределение графика работы
Иногда возникают нестандартные ситуации, которые не покрываются типовыми документами-основаниями. Например, сотруднику был предоставлен отгул по устной договоренности с руководителем, который позже был оформлен приказом, но в систему приказ еще не введен. В таких случаях специалисты по кадрому учету прибегают к ручному редактированию ячеек табеля, игнорируя плановый график.
Чтобы внести такие изменения, убедитесь, что в настройках вида расчета или параметров учета разрешено ручное редактирование табеля. Откройте документ табеля и найдите нужную дату. Кликните по ячейке с плановым временем. Обычно система предлагает выбрать код из списка, основанного на графике. Вам нужно выбрать код неявки или явки вручную.
При ручном вводе кодов, таких как Г (государственные обязанности) или ОВ (отпуск без сохранения зарплаты), система может не автоматически рассчитать часы. Вам придется вписать количество часов самостоятельно. Будьте предельно внимательны: сумма часов не должна противоречить трудовому договору, если только это не оформлено как сверхурочная работа или работа в выходной день.
- 🔍 Сверьте ручной ввод с бумажным носителем (приказом или распоряжением).
- 🚫 Избегайте использования «серых» схем ввода, когда табель расходится с реальными документами.
- ⚖️ Помните, что ручной ввод в табеле не создает движений по регистрам накопления для расчета отпускных.
Следует отметить, что частое использование ручного ввода является признаком плохой организации документооборота. В идеале любая неявка должна проводиться через соответствующий документ в 1С:ЗУП, который автоматически обновит табель. Ручные правки допустимы лишь как временная мера до внесения первичного документа.
⚠️ Внимание! Ручное изменение часов в табеле без создания документа-основания не повлияет на расчет среднего заработка за прошлые периоды. Если сотруднику нужен перерасчет отпускных, использование только табеля недостаточно.
Массовое изменение данных и работа со списком сотрудников
В крупных организациях с численностью штата в сотни человек поочередное исправление ячеек для каждого сотрудника становится неэффективным. К счастью, интерфейс 1С:Предприятие предоставляет инструменты для групповой обработки данных в табеле. Это особенно актуально при массовых простоях, объявлении выходных дней или изменении режима работы целого отдела.
Для массового изменения используйте режим работы со списком. Выделите мышью диапазон ячеек, охватывающий нескольких сотрудников и несколько дат. Нажатие правой кнопки мыши вызовет контекстное меню, где доступны опции заполнения. Вы можете выбрать команду «Заполнить кодом явки» и указать нужный символ, например, НВ (неявка по невыясненным причинам) или В (выходной).
Также полезна функция копирования графика. Если весь отдел переводится на новый режим, можно скопировать данные из одного корректно заполненного табеля в другой или использовать обработку «Заполнение табеля». В меню Еще → Заполнить доступны различные варианты автоматизации, позволяющие быстро привести данные к единому стандарту.
☑️ Алгоритм массового исправления
При массовых операциях высок риск случайной перезаписи индивидуальных данных, например, дней болезни или отпуска, которые уже были внесены корректно. Всегда используйте фильтрацию списка перед выделением диапазона. Убедитесь, что в выделенную область не попали сотрудники с особыми условиями труда или уже оформленными неявками.
Проверка корректности и влияние на расчет зарплаты
После внесения любых изменений, будь то ручная правка или ввод документа-основания, критически важно проверить, как эти изменения отразились на итоговых расчетах. Табель учета рабочего времени является источником данных для регистров накопления, которые, в свою очередь, питают расчетный листок сотрудника.
Используйте отчет Анализ состояния учета заработной платы или Свод начислений и удержаний, чтобы увидеть расхождения. Если вы изменили явку с «Я» на «Б», сумма начисленной зарплаты должна уменьшиться (если больничный оплачивается отдельно), а сумма больничного — появиться в соответствующей графе. Отсутствие таких изменений сигнализирует о том, что табель не перепроведен или документ-основание не попал в расчет.
Особое внимание уделите нормативам. При изменении количества отработанных дней может измениться норма времени за месяц, что повлияет на расчет оклада. Если сотрудник отработал неполный месяц, система должна корректно рассчитать долю оклада. Проверка этого параметра осуществляется в отчете Табель-календарь.
- ✅ Запустите перерасчет зарплаты для измененных сотрудников.
- 📊 Сравните расчетный листок «До» и «После» внесения правок.
- 📑 Убедитесь, что в печатной форме Т-13 отражены актуальные данные.
Если данные в табеле и в расчете расходятся, попробуйте выполнить операцию «Пересчет зарплаты» заново, убедившись, что галочка учета табельных данных активна. В сложных случаях может потребоваться удаление ошибочных движений регистров и повторное проведение всей цепочки документов.
Любое изменение в табеле требует обязательного перепроведения документа и, возможно, перерасчета заработной платы для вступления изменений в силу.
Часто задаваемые вопросы (FAQ)
Можно ли изменить табель, если месяц уже закрыт и сдан отчет в ФНС?
Технически это возможно, но требует открытия закрытого периода. Вам необходимо найти обработку «Закрытие месяца», открыть нужный период и снять флаг закрытия. После внесения изменений в табель и перерасчета зарплаты период нужно закрыть заново. Будьте готовы к тому, что придется подавать уточненную отчетность, если изменения повлияли на налоговую базу.
Почему при ручном вводе часов система выдает ошибку «Превышение нормы»?
Эта ошибка возникает, когда введенное количество часов превышает лимит, установленный в производственном календаре или графике работы сотрудника на этот день. Чтобы обойти ограничение (например, для оформления сверхурочных), необходимо использовать специальные коды явок, предполагающие работу за пределами нормы, или явно указать вид времени как сверхурочный в настройках.
Как исправить ошибку, если сотрудник был уволен, а в табеле стоят явки после даты увольнения?
Вам нужно открыть документ Увольнение и проверить дату прекращения трудового договора. Если дата верна, а в табеле есть лишние записи, откройте табель и очистите ячейки после даты увольнения. Если документ увольнения еще не проведен, проведите его — система автоматически должна обрезать табель по дату увольнения, но ручной контроль не помешает.
Влияет ли исправление табеля на расчет стажа для отпуска?
Да, влияет напрямую. Коды явок и неявок определяют, входит ли период в стаж, дающий право на ежегодный оплачиваемый отпуск. Замена кода «Я» на «НВ» (отпуск без сохранения зарплаты более 14 дней) сдвинет дату права на отпуск. После исправления табеля рекомендуется пересчитать регистры накопления по отпускам.